When running nix flake check I get this error:
error: a 'aarch64-darwin' with features {} is required to build '/nix/store/wprydkf14qwvnnyz8vvhbn7rbhchr8rz-cabal2nix-borsh.drv', but I am a 'x86_64-linux' with features {benchmark, big-parallel, kvm, nixos-test, uid-range}
I am importing these libraries into the main flake like this:
flake-parts.lib.mkFlake {inherit inputs;} {
systems = nixpkgs.lib.systems.flakeExposed;
imports = [
inputs.haskell-flake.flakeModule
];
perSystem = {
self',
config,
pkgs,
inputs',
system,
...
}: {
haskellProjects.default = {
imports = [
inputs.zcash-haskell.haskellFlakeProjectModules.output
inputs.persistent-sqlite.haskellFlakeProjectModules.output
inputs.qrc.haskellFlakeProjectModules.output
];
...
};
The new addition is the qrc library and I don't understand why this is causing nix to try to build the wrong architecture for borsh. All these flakes pass their checks and build correctly on their own.
